What is the difference between Machine Operator Packer vs Machine Operator?

AspectMachine Operator PackerMachine Operator
CredentialsHigh school diploma, on-the-job trainingHigh school diploma, technical training often required
Work EnvironmentManufacturing, packaging linesManufacturing, production facilities
Job FocusOperating packaging machinery, packing productsOperating various manufacturing equipment
Common Industry UsageYesYes

Machine Operator Packer and Machine Operator roles both involve operating machinery in manufacturing settings. The main difference is that Machine Operator Packer specifically focuses on packaging and packing products, while Machine Operator may handle a broader range of manufacturing equipment. Both roles typically require similar certifications and work in similar environments, but their job duties differ based on the production stage.

Job Summary:.

To set-up and operate necessary equipment to produce a custom extruded profile that will meet or exceed the customer’s expectations.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Ability to set-up equipment (dies, screws, downline equipment, etc.) to make line production capable.
  • Be able to start up all machinery and equipment while making any adjustments necessary to obtain a high quality extruded product.
  • Assume responsibility for safety and housekeeping by following all safety rules, reporting safety hazards, and maintaining a clean work area.
  • Assume responsibility for quality of extruded products by completing check sheets, color checks, SPC (Statistical Process Controls) computer data entry, and any other special reports that may be required.
  • Assume responsibility for packaging quality by insuring that required packing materials are available and products are packed correctly.
  • Assist in the training of new trainees by sharing knowledge and information.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

Qualifications, Education and/or Experience:

  • High school diploma or GED required
  • Some manufacturing and/or technical experience desirable.
  • Must be able to use a tape measure, length gauge, and precision measuring instruments such as calipers, micrometers, and various quality gauges.
  • Must have good mechanical aptitude and acceptable math skills (i.e., division, multiplication, fraction to decimal conversion, etc.) Must possess basic knowledge of raw materials (virgin, regrinds, colorants, etc.) used in extrusion process.
